    Chloe C.

    Food - ordered a bunch of skewers and food but my favorites were enoki mushrooms, cucumber salad, and korean cold noodles! was not a fan of their "little skewers" per se. felt like the meat was so little that i could barely taste it. Service - super busy but got seated fairly quickly. Ambiance - has live karaoke where a staff sings and you can pay $20 i think to request or sing yourself. Not the best place to catch up with friends cause you can't really hear due to the music. Overall, not a huge fan of the meat skewers but the mushrooms and korean cold noodles and other dishes were SOO good. RECOMMENDED DISHES: garlic enoki mushroom, cucumber salad, cold noodles, cauliflower, fish tofu!!

    Pauline T.

    This review should've been posted earlier, but this is my go to spot for Chinese skewers :) Food: The menu is pretty diverse. My favorites are the premium marbled beef, pork belly, and cauliflower. Both meats are always very soft and easy to bite off the skewer. Be warned though, pretty much everything here has the same seasoning/can be salty and the meat is small (these aren't big kebabs or anything), so you're out of luck if you don't like strong cumin flavor or are expecting big yakitori style skewers. The restaurant is called LITTLE SKEWER for a reason! I think to accompany the skewers, you definitely need to get the malatang pot. It's filled with glass noodles, different types of fish cake, sausage, thinly sliced beef, Napa cabbage, and the soup is nice and numbing. I don't know if it's because I was really hungry but this was so good and I'll be ordering it every time I come back. Service: Service here is good. The servers are friendly and even played games with some customers when I was there. The skewers also come out relatively quickly. Restaurant/cleanliness: the restaurant itself is themed well like you're in an ancient Chinese drama. I've never had this issue before but I guess some rice had gotten stuck to our water cups and I only saw that as I was about to drink. There was also some sponge piece that had gotten stuck to the soup ladle we were given. The servers were really apologetic about that.
